随着互联网技术的飞速发展,边缘计算逐渐成为计算领域的新热点。边缘计算通过将数据处理和分析任务从云端转移到网络边缘,实现了更快的响应速度、更低的延迟和更高的安全性。在边缘计算领域,NPM(Node Package Manager)作为一种重要的包管理工具,发挥着越来越重要的作用。本文将探讨云原生NPM在边缘计算领域的探索与应用。

一、云原生NPM概述

云原生NPM是指基于云计算架构的NPM,它将NPM的功能扩展到云环境中,实现了在云平台上对NPM的部署、管理和优化。云原生NPM具有以下特点:

  1. 弹性伸缩:根据业务需求,自动调整NPM资源,满足不同场景下的性能要求。

  2. 高可用性:通过分布式部署,提高NPM系统的稳定性和可靠性。

  3. 自动化运维:实现NPM的自动化部署、监控、故障排查和性能优化。

  4. 丰富的生态支持:兼容现有的NPM生态,方便用户迁移和应用。

二、云原生NPM在边缘计算领域的优势

  1. 提高响应速度:边缘计算将数据处理和分析任务从云端转移到网络边缘,减少了数据传输距离,降低了延迟。云原生NPM可以快速部署和更新边缘节点上的应用程序,进一步缩短响应时间。

  2. 降低网络负载:通过边缘计算,部分数据处理任务可以在边缘节点完成,减少了数据传输量,降低了网络负载。

  3. 提高安全性:云原生NPM可以实现对边缘节点的安全防护,防止恶意攻击和数据泄露。

  4. 优化资源利用率:云原生NPM可以根据边缘节点的实际需求,动态调整资源分配,提高资源利用率。

三、云原生NPM在边缘计算领域的应用场景

  1. 物联网(IoT):云原生NPM可以用于管理边缘节点上的物联网设备,实现设备的快速部署、升级和维护。

  2. 边缘计算平台:云原生NPM可以用于构建和管理边缘计算平台,提供丰富的API和服务,方便开发者进行应用开发。

  3. 边缘数据中心:云原生NPM可以用于管理边缘数据中心中的服务器、存储和网络设备,实现资源的自动化调度和优化。

  4. 边缘人工智能(AI):云原生NPM可以用于管理边缘AI节点,实现AI模型的快速部署、训练和推理。

四、云原生NPM在边缘计算领域的挑战与展望

  1. 挑战

(1)边缘节点资源的有限性:边缘节点的计算、存储和网络资源相对有限,对云原生NPM的性能提出了更高要求。

(2)跨平台兼容性:云原生NPM需要支持多种操作系统和硬件平台,以满足不同场景下的需求。

(3)安全性和隐私保护:边缘计算涉及到大量的敏感数据,对云原生NPM的安全性和隐私保护提出了更高要求。


  1. 展望

(1)优化资源调度策略:通过智能调度算法,实现边缘节点的资源优化配置,提高资源利用率。

(2)加强跨平台兼容性:提高云原生NPM在不同操作系统和硬件平台上的兼容性,降低开发成本。

(3)强化安全性和隐私保护:采用先进的加密技术和访问控制策略,确保边缘计算过程中的数据安全和隐私保护。

总之,云原生NPM在边缘计算领域具有广阔的应用前景。通过不断优化和改进,云原生NPM将为边缘计算的发展提供有力支持,推动计算领域的技术创新和应用普及。

猜你喜欢:全景性能监控